Docketing Paralegal (Docketing Specialist)
Shook, Hardy & Bacon L.L.P. is seeking a Docketing Specialist responsible for multi-jurisdictional litigation calendaring and docketing services. The role involves managing deadlines, supporting litigation teams, and ensuring compliance with various legal rules and procedures.
ConsultingLegalMedical DevicePharmaceuticalTelecommunications
Responsibilities
Reviews documents for relevant dates and enters deadlines into the firm's docketing/calendaring system, BEC (or similar docketing software), following docketing policies and procedures
Creates, reviews and distributes calendar and case reports
Responds to requests from litigation team members regarding docketed events and deadlines, court procedures and rules
Works independently to recognize docketing anomalies and conducts appropriate research to resolve same
Assists in the investigation of docket issues and implementing solutions to mitigate future issues, if needed
Creates and maintains documentation for docketing processes, procedures, guidelines and practices
Provides back-up support to Client Service Specialists and Legal Operations Specialists
Stays abreast of industry best practices, docketing system(s) and technical considerations to present options to enhance the practice, increase efficiencies, and meet client needs
Assists with ad hoc projects, as needed
